Output 511510562f90f9f4db9f749ce773c89887ad442092b384e19ecb7705043b37f1: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81edf575ccd628c3dab8b008c8ee525ab2032ae5 OP_EQUAL
address
3DY29xaqynvkNifTYZfhv9HxbEMsnUw7QR
transaction
511510562f90f9f4db9f749ce773c89887ad442092b384e19ecb7705043b37f1
spent
true